Understanding Traffic Patterns and Timing
Successful navigation in most iterations of this style of game isn't just about quick reflexes; it’s about understanding the underlying logic of the traffic flow. While the visual presentation might seem chaotic, most games employ discernible patterns. Observing these patterns is the key to maximizing your chicken’s survival rate. For instance, pay attention to the gaps between vehicles – are they consistent, or do they vary in length? Do certain lanes have a higher density of traffic than others? Identifying these tendencies allows you to predict when safe crossing opportunities will arise. Waiting for the right moment, even if it means delaying your advance, is often far more effective than rushing into a potentially fatal situation. Moreover, learning to anticipate the speed of approaching vehicles is crucial. Smaller, faster cars can be more dangerous than larger, slower trucks, as they leave less time to react.
Developing a Rhythmic Approach
Many players discover that adopting a rhythmic approach to crossing significantly improves their performance. Instead of reacting to each vehicle individually, try to establish a consistent timing based on the overall flow of traffic. This might involve waiting for a specific type of vehicle to pass before making your move, or focusing on the gaps between cars rather than the cars themselves. This approach requires practice and a keen sense of observation, but it can transform the game from a frantic test of reflexes into a more controlled and strategic experience. It’s about moving with the traffic, rather than constantly fighting against it. This also helps to conserve mental energy, allowing you to focus for longer play sessions.
| Traffic Density | Recommended Strategy |
|---|---|
| Low | Consistent, rhythmic crossings. Focus on maximizing distance between moves. |
| Medium | Careful observation of gaps. Prioritize safety over speed. |
| High | Precise timing and quick reactions are essential. Look for small windows of opportunity. |
Adjusting your play style based on the traffic density is vital. As seen in the table above, different situations call for different tactics. Mastering this adaptability is what separates casual players from high-scoring champions.
Utilizing Power-Ups and Special Items
Many versions of the chicken road game introduce power-ups and special items to add another layer of complexity and excitement. These can range from shields that protect your chicken from a single collision, to speed boosts that allow you to quickly traverse multiple lanes, or even temporary freezes that halt traffic altogether. The key to effectively utilizing these power-ups is knowing when to deploy them strategically. For instance, saving a shield for a particularly challenging section of the road, or using a speed boost to quickly clear a congested area. Blindly activating power-ups without considering the current game state is a recipe for disaster. Understanding the duration and limitations of each power-up is equally important. A speed boost might get you across several lanes quickly, but it can also make it harder to control your chicken and react to sudden changes in traffic.

Strategic Use of the Double-Cross
A particularly daring technique employed by experienced players is the "double-cross." This involves initiating a lane change right before an oncoming vehicle reaches your current lane, then immediately changing lanes again to avoid the collision. This maneuver requires incredibly precise timing and a deep understanding of the game’s mechanics, but it can be incredibly effective for navigating congested areas or reaching otherwise inaccessible power-ups. It is also an extremely risky move: mistiming the second lane change will inevitably result in a game over. The double-cross demonstrates the high skill ceiling of even seemingly simple games like the chicken road game, offering a constant challenge for players seeking to push their limits.

The Psychology Behind the Addictive Gameplay
The enduring popularity of this style of game isn’t simply down to its simple mechanics; it’s rooted in fundamental psychological principles. The constant threat of failure, combined with the frequent opportunities for success, triggers the release of dopamine in the brain, creating a rewarding and addictive experience. Each successful crossing provides a small but satisfying hit of dopamine, encouraging players to continue playing in pursuit of that next reward. The escalating difficulty also plays a crucial role, constantly challenging players and preventing them from becoming bored. Furthermore, the game’s simplicity makes it easily accessible to a wide audience, while its high skill ceiling provides a sense of mastery for those who are willing to invest the time and effort to improve their skills.
